What does a higher price
for a good tell a producer?

Respuesta :

raleemthomas05
raleemthomas05 raleemthomas05
  • 04-03-2020

Answer:

A higher price for a good tells the producer to produce more as higher price means more profit. Higher price for a god encourage new producer to produce good and enter the market to earn profit.
